This article examines the impact of tax-in-kind on the economic condition of collective farm peasants in Altai Krai during the Great Patriotic War. The study explores key trends in state policy related to in-kind taxation, the mechanisms used by the government to regulate it, and analyzes the capacity of kolkhoz peasants to fulfill their tax obligations in kind.
